Expected to cross the coast at Cooktown at 5pm. Massive tide 1.5 meters 'higher than the highest tide you have ever seen', many inches of rain up and down the North Queensland coast and winds of 300km/hr.
People are advised to leave their homes and go to evacuation centers if the house was built before 1985 and others are advised to bunk down in their bathroom.
